Poweroff enables you to schedule any of the following actions: shutdown, reboot, logoff, poweroff, standby, hibernate, lock, wake-on-LAN at a certain time. It contains a built-in scheduler and allows you to run another program before doing the action, issue a warning message, or wait for a process to finish before performing the action. Command-line options are also supported.

Not portable..
Store settings in registry:
HKEY_CURRENT_USER\SOFTWARE\Poweroff
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Services\Poweroff\Parameters
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\System\ControlSet00x\Services\PowerOff
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\System\ControlSet00x\Enum\Root\LEGACY_POWEROFF
